Ella Mila nail polish is a popular choice for consumers seeking vegan, cruelty-free, and “7-Free” formulas, meaning they are made without seven common toxic chemicals. Major Retail Partners
Ella Mila has a partnership with Target, making it a convenient option for in-person shopping. However, availability is not universal. Target typically stocks a curated selection of popular colors and collections rather than the entire range. Shoppers are advised to check Target’s website or app to confirm stock at a specific location before visiting. Looking in the cosmetics aisle, often near other nail care brands emphasizing natural ingredients, can help locate the products in-store.
Online Beauty Retailers
A wider selection of Ella Mila nail polish is often available through various online beauty retailers. These platforms specialize in clean, vegan, and cruelty-free cosmetics and frequently carry niche brands. Popular online retailers mentioned include: * Amazon, which offers a vast selection of shades, often with competitive pricing. * Petit Vour, a retailer specializing in vegan beauty products. * The Detox Market, known for its curated selection of clean beauty brands. * Credo Beauty, another retailer focused on clean and sustainable beauty products.
When purchasing from these third-party online retailers, it is important to verify the seller’s authenticity. The Ella Mila website may list authorized retailers, and consumers are advised to exercise caution if a retailer is not listed. Reading customer reviews and understanding the retailer's return policy can help ensure a positive shopping experience.

Understanding the Product and Offers
Ella Mila’s “7-Free” formula is a key selling point, indicating the absence of seven specific chemicals: Formaldehyde, Formaldehyde Resin, Toluene, Dibutyl Phthalate (DBP), Camphor, TPHP, and Xylene. The brand is also certified vegan and cruelty-free. Regarding pricing, Ella Mila nail polishes are often slightly more expensive than traditional brands due to their higher-quality ingredients and formulation, though many consumers consider the health benefits a worthwhile investment.
